Legitimate Ways to Improve Your Tarkov Gameplay
Improving your Tarkov gameplay requires a methodical approach beyond simple repetition. Dedicate time to learning specific maps offline, focusing on extraction points, loot spawns, and high-traffic areas to predict enemy movement. Meticulous inventory management and understanding ballistics are crucial for survival. Furthermore, consistent aim training and mastering point-firing will win more engagements. Finally, studying comprehensive Escape from Tarkov guides from experienced players can provide invaluable insights into complex mechanics, significantly accelerating your progress and overall effectiveness in raids.
Mastering Map Knowledge and Extraction Points
Mastering EFT survival tactics requires a methodical approach beyond mere gunplay. Dedicate time to learning high-traffic areas and extraction points on each map through offline raids. Utilize your scavenger runs to generate risk-free income and learn PvP engagements. Meticulously manage your hideout to craft valuable items and enhance your character’s recovery stats. Finally, record and review your deaths to analyze positioning mistakes and adapt your strategies for future raids.

Utilizing Offline Mode for Practice and Strategy
To improve your Tarkov skills, focus on mastering core mechanics. Spend time in your Hideout crafting essential items and use offline raids to learn maps and practice against Scavs. Study detailed maps online to understand loot hotspots, extraction points, and common player routes. Prioritize survival over firefights; sometimes avoiding a fight is the smartest tactical play. Consistent practice and map knowledge are your greatest assets for a successful raid.
